These melted witch cookies made from Betty Crocker® peanut butter cookie mix, Bugles® snacks and cocoa candy melts are a bewitching Halloween dessert!
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Dessert
Time 1h45m
Yield 30
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at oven to 375°F. In large bowl, stir cookie mix, oil, water and egg until soft dough forms. Onto ungreased cookie sheets, drop dough by rounded measuring tablespoonfuls 2 inches apart.
- Bake 9 to 11 minutes or until set. Cool 1 minute; remove from cookie sheets to cooling racks. Cool completely.
- Line cookie sheet with waxed paper. Dip snacks in melted candy; tap off excess. Place on cookie sheet. Refrigerate until firm.
- Reheat remaining candy melts, if necessary. Frost each cookie with melted candy to look like a puddle. Immediately attach 1 pretzel piece to each cookie; sprinkle shredded cereal onto bottom of pretzel to look like broom bristles. Dip wide end of each chocolate-coated snack in melted candy; place upright in center of each cookie for hat. Let stand until set.
